Green, selective and reproducible preparation for LC-MS analysis

The ETN-12 is a laboratory system for Electromembrane Extraction (EME) and Liquid Membrane Extraction (LME), offering a modern and fundamentally different approach to sample preparation compared to conventional techniques such as liquid-liquid extraction and solid-phase extraction.

The system is built around a supported liquid membrane positioned between a sample solution and a clean aqueous acceptor phase. Depending on analytical requirements, analytes are transported either by applying an electrical field (EME mode) or by controlled diffusion across the membrane (LME mode). This dual capability provides methodological flexibility within one instrument platform and enables laboratories to select the extraction mechanism best suited to their analytes and matrices.

In EME mode, charged analytes are actively driven through the membrane under an applied voltage. The combination of electrical control and membrane chemistry introduces an additional level of selectivity beyond traditional extraction principles. Ionizable compounds can be efficiently isolated from complex matrices such as plasma, serum, urine, oral fluid and environmental samples. At the same time, proteins, phospholipids and many endogenous matrix components are excluded during extraction, resulting in highly purified aqueous extracts.

Cleaner extracts have direct operational benefits in LC-MS/MS workflows. Reduced matrix components contribute to lower ion suppression, less contamination of ion sources and LC columns, and a lower frequency of instrument maintenance. Improved instrument uptime and reduced downtime on critical mass spectrometry systems support both laboratory productivity and cost efficiency.

In LME mode, extraction is performed without voltage and relies on membrane selectivity and partitioning. This provides a complementary extraction approach when electrical driving force is not required, further expanding the application range of the platform.

Compared to classical multi-step extraction procedures, ETN-12 integrates extraction and clean-up into a streamlined process where the acceptor phase can typically be injected directly into the analytical system. Reduced sample handling minimizes variability and supports reproducible performance.

The instrument processes up to 12 samples in parallel. In EME mode, individual current monitoring for each extraction cell provides documentation of membrane stability and operational performance, contributing to robust method development and traceability.

ETN-12 is also a green sample preparation technology. Only microliter volumes of non-volatile organic solvent are used per sample, significantly reducing solvent consumption and hazardous waste compared to traditional extraction methods. This supports safer laboratory operation and improved environmental sustainability.

With validated generic methods for basic and acidic analytes across broad polarity ranges, ETN-12 is well suited for pharmaceutical analysis and impurity testing, bioanalysis and therapeutic drug monitoring, forensic and toxicological investigations, veterinary applications, and environmental monitoring of contaminants and micropollutants.

By combining membrane-based selectivity, electrical control and sustainable operation, ETN-12 provides laboratories with a next-generation extraction platform aligned with the evolving demands of modern analytical chemistry.
